good morning. i am kasie hunt on this friday, july 9th. we made it, and we ll start with the news. with the delta variant surge across the country, biden officials are offering another warning to americans still not vaccinated against the coronavirus. the seven-day average of covid-19 cases in the u.s. has gone up by about 11% since last week, particularly in states where the vaccination rates remain low. we are starting to see some new and concerning events. in some cases hospitalizations are up. we re seeing outbreaks of covid-19 in locations such as camps and community events where proper hard-learned strategies are not in force and the variant is able to strive.

the delta variant is the dominant strain, but in some parts of the country lie the midwest and upper mountain states, that number is closer to 80%. meanwhile pfizer is working on a booster shot. the company says clinical studies could begin as early as august, subject to regulatory approvals. executives from pfizer have repeatedly said people will likely need a booster shot or possible third dose of the vaccine within 12 months of being fully vaccinated. meanwhile the biden administration is renewing its push to pass voting rights legislation. president biden and vice president harris met with a delegation of civil rights leaders at the white house yesterday to discuss how to combat the wave of restrictive voting laws. civil rights activists argued the need. democracy is under vigorous, vicious, and sinister attack,

beginning with the events of june january 6th at the capitol and cascading like a tsunami through state legislatures across the nation. the movement from the ground up is starting to be the only way that we can preserve our right to vote. we informed them that this is going to come not from the white house down but from our houses up. i told the president we will not be able to litigate our way out of this threat to black citizenship, voting, and political participation. we need legislation to be passed in congress, both h.r. 1 and h.r. 4. vice president harris announced the democratic national committee is invest 25g million in their voting rights campaign i will vote. texas republicans,
